(A) Immunofluorescence microscopy showing neutrophil extracellular traps, defined as colocalized extracellular DNA (blue), neutrophil elastase (NE) (green), and histone (red), present in the lung after hilar clamp (HC) but not after sham surgery. Scale bar = 10 μm. Results are representative of at least three independent experiments. (B, C) NE-DNA complexes are increased in plasma after HC (C) but are not increased in bronchoalveolar lavage fluid (B). n ≥ 6 for all groups, *P < 0.05. BALF = bronchoalveolar lavage fluid.
